Chance to see real "star turn’
Youcanwatchreal life stars insteadofthoseon the television this Friday evening as part of the calendar of events arranged to celebrate thesoth anniversary of the Forest of Bowland’s designation as an Area of Outstanding Natural Beauty. You will, however, need to wrap up warm and take a flask and torch over to Abbeystead where there’s a presenta- ■ tion on the night sky.
Followingthat,weatherpermitting,youwillbeinvited. to do a bit of stargazing on the edge of the Bowland Fells. There is a £3 charge and the event is deemed suitable for adults and children aged 12 plus. Booking is required, so you need to call Sandra Silk on 01200 448000 or email her at sandra. silk@lancashire.
